    I had my application returned today bc I used the form given by the link in the original post. MSP says that form is no longer being accepted AND handwritten applications are also no longer being accepted. The form must now be filled out online and printed then signed and mailed along with any and all supporting documents. There is also no longer a need to have the application notarized. The application fee is $75

    You can't really "download" the application bc it has hidden "pop-up" questions that appear depending on how you answer the previous question. That's why they say it must be completed online then printed out and signed
